Jump to content

Champ texte apparaissant sur les factures


Zeff

Recommended Posts

Appel aux développeurs de tous poils !

Je cherche une solution pour pouvoir ajouter (dans le BO) un champ texte à une commande. Ce champ texte doit pouvoir apparaître dans la facture générée en PDF. Dans mon cas, il s'agit de pouvoir indiquer les numéros de série des produits vendus, mais il me semble qu'une telle amélioration pourrait servir à de nombreux utilisateurs. J'ai déjà contacté Julien Breux à ce sujet, mais il semble qu'il soit très occupé par le montage de son activité. Donc, si vous avez une piste... C'est urgent !

Cordialement

Link to comment
Share on other sites

il existe un module gratuit d'un de nos dev preferes julien breux " factures personnalise v1 regarde sur le forum sinon je te donne l'adresse la il est tard ou tot colle tu veux lol

je ne sais pas si c'est ce que tu cherches c'est une indication uniquement sur la facttureen pdf donc generaliste ça n'ajoute pas de champ pour chaque produit mais par contre ds ta fiche produit tu as un champ reference tu peux peut etre t'en servir et changer l'intitule ds traduction a voir avec des marchands plus cpmpetents sur ps

Link to comment
Share on other sites

il existe un module gratuit d'un de nos dev preferes julien breux " factures personnalise v1


Je connais ce module : c'est d'ailleurs pourquoi j'avais joint Julien Breux en priorité. Mais il semble très occupé ces temps-ci...

je ne sais pas si c'est ce que tu cherches c'est une indication uniquement sur la facttureen pdf donc generaliste ça n'ajoute pas de champ pour chaque produit mais par contre ds ta fiche produit tu as un champ reference tu peux peut etre t'en servir et changer l'intitule ds traduction a voir avec des marchands plus cpmpetents sur ps


Je ne cherche pas à ajouter un champ à un produit mais à une commande, ce qui est fondamentalement différent. Et il faut que ce champ apparaisse sur la facture PDF correspondante.

Merci de ton aide

Jean
Link to comment
Share on other sites

Salut pppplus,

C'est effectivement ta seconde proposition qui est la bonne !
Je vends des instruments de musique et chaque instrument a son propre numéro de série.
C'est comme pour les voitures, les iPods, les téléphones portables, etc...
Donc, si j'ai 20 trompettes identiques en stock, j'ai 20 numéros de série différents...
Et, évidemment, ce numéro unique doit apparaître sur la facture pour que les assurances acceptent de couvrir d'éventuels sinistres.

Merci de toutes les pistes que vous pourrez me donner !

Jean

Link to comment
Share on other sites

Donc, à part créer un champ texte libre (parce que c'est beaucoup plus versatile qu'une adaptation spécifique) dans la commande, je ne vois pas trop comment faire... Evidemment, il ne s'agit pas simplement de générer ce champ (ça, je sais faire...) mais de créer une variable de son contenu qui sera enregistrée avec la commande dans la base MySQL et pourra ensuite être récupérée par le fichier générateur de la facture en PDF. Sur ce dernier point, je peux également me débrouiller. Mais je ne connais rien à la gestion des variables avec MySQL... C'est pourquoi j'ai besoin d'aide !

Il s'agit donc d'un petit développement (que je suis prêt à rémunérer) qui est indispensable pour moi mais devrait également rendre de bons services à d'autres utilisateurs Prestashop ! Je ne dois tout de même pas être le seul à vendre des objets ayant des numéros de série !

Jean

Link to comment
Share on other sites

Bonjour,

Je viens de relire tes besoins pour la mise en place d'un système de numéro de série différents pour chaque facture, par produit, etc.... J'avais juste une question : A quel moment et dans quelle écran tu envisages qu'il soit saisi ?

Link to comment
Share on other sites

Bonsoir et merci de ton intérêt pour mon problème,

La saisie de ce champ texte doit pouvoir se faire depuis:
Panneau d'administration >>Commandes
Ci-dessous, une proposition d'intégration...
Mais toute autre présentation peut convenir !

D'avance merci de ce que tu pourras faire.

Jean

17310_j6beaW4xQR26Z80zbBgA_t

Link to comment
Share on other sites

Re-bonsoir leforum2003,

Un doute m'assaille : mes explications sont-elles assez précises ?
Il me semble que oui, d'autant que l'idée est de faire une modification générique pouvant servir à d'autres utilisateurs.
Si, toutefois, je n'avais pas été assez clair, n'hésite pas à me contacter.

Bonne soirée

Jean

Link to comment
Share on other sites

  • 3 months later...
  • 1 month later...
  • 4 weeks later...
  • 3 months later...

Bonjour

Moi aussi je suis sur le coup. Car j'ai besoin aussi de cela.
J'ai déjà bricolé des modules comme tout le monde.
J'ai commencé à analyser ce problème au niveau du PDF.
Je cherche des pistes encore avant de me lancer dans le développement. Savez vous comment accèder à la page de commande par hook? Y a t-il un hook dédié? J'ai tenté le hook "invoice" mais sans résultat.
Si vous avez des pistes, merci.

Link to comment
Share on other sites

  • 1 month later...

Bonjour,

Bonsoir,
J'ai beau tapez "factures personnalise v1" dans les recherches mais je retombe toujours sur ce post! Quelle est l'adresse exacte du module?

merci bonne soirée


Voici l'adresse direct pour le module "custom Invoice v1.1"
Il a été créer par Julien Breux sur son site tu trouvera d'autre fonctionnalité bien pratique pour ton prestashop.

Merci à lui au passage.

Je suis par ailleurs moi aussi intéressée par ce type de champs de personnalisation 'zone de texte libre' via le BO >> commandes.

Sinon quelqu'un pourrait m'aider a rajouter le mail du client de manière automatique dans la facture pdf sous le champs livraison ou facturation ?

Je n'ai pas trouvé le code a rajouter dans pdf.php...

Merci par avance de l'attention que vous portez a ma question

Isa
Link to comment
Share on other sites

Bonjour,

Je peux vous le rajouter automatiquement dans les lignes prévues à cette effet, mais c'est tout car Prestashop dans son cœur ne le prévoit pas en tant que simple module.

Communautairement vôtre !


Bonsoir et déjà merci ,

Si nous parlons bien de ceci :
Sinon quelqu’un pourrait m’aider a rajouter le mail du client de manière automatique dans la facture pdf sous le champs livraison ou facturation ?


Alors oui pour ma part je suis preneuse de l'info du code a rajouter avec l'info où et le nom du ou des fichiers à modifier. pour info, je suis sous prestashop 1.2.5

Merci par avance pour tous.

Sympa le clin d'œil "amicalement vôtre" avec le communautairement vôtre ;-)
Link to comment
Share on other sites

  • 1 month later...

Bonjour,

Je m'auto-réponds, en fait le module "custom invoice" de JBX permet d'ajouter uniquement une information générique commune à chaque facture.

Quelqu'un aurait il trouvé la solution pour ajouter une information unique de type N° de fabrication ou n° de série, sur la commande, le BL ou la facture d'un client dans le Back office après la validation de sa commande.

Merci pour vos retours.

Link to comment
Share on other sites

@pourpresta
Bonjour,
En effet, il y aura plusieurs numéros de série.
1-l'idéal sera de les insérer en dessous de la ligne correspondante. Exemple:
3 trompettes
N°xxx1, N°xxx2, N°xxx3
Et cela sous chaque produits nécessitant une information complémentaire communiquée par le marchand au moment de la mise en colis

2-Autre solution moins parfaite avoir une zone de type champ libre dans le bon de commande ou on peut préciser ces numéros.
Ces informations étant reprises dans la facture.

Bonne journée.

Link to comment
Share on other sites

  • 2 weeks later...

Bonjour,

En faisant un petite modification, je peux faire en sorte que ce ne soit que les messages de votre part qui apparaissent sur le BL.

Dans ce cas, vous vous servez des messages client pour communiquer les numéros de séries.

Ces messages viennent se glisser tout en bas du BL.

Je pense que cela peut être une bonne alternative sachant qu'il n'y a qu'un hook sur les pdfs et que vous ne pourriez donc pas faire apparaitre votre message sur la même ligne que le produit concerné.

Cordialement

Link to comment
Share on other sites

Bonsoir,

Je ne vois pas vraiment comment mettre en oeuvre ce besoin.

par contre, j'ai une autre idée pour détourner l'utilisation de mon module.

On pourrait dire que tout message commençant par tels caractères seraient affichés.

Qu'en pensez vous ? Je ne pense pas que ce soit la solution miracle mais devoir lister les messages de chaque commande... Je ne vois pas comment garder une bonne ergonomie.

Bonne soirée

Cordialement

Link to comment
Share on other sites

Bonjour Pourpresta,
Très bonne idée, ca me convient. Un # serait parfait. Quand cela pourrait être dispo? Allez vous l'implanter sur le module en vente le store ou bien il faudra faire un hack?
J'attends vos infos.

Link to comment
Share on other sites

Bonjour,

Je propose de faire un hack sur le module Message Client sur le BL car un nouveau module détournant l'utilisation des messages clients à cette fin n'est pas sûr d'être validé facilement.

L'idéal serait que les personnes achetant le module et souhaitant s'en servir comme proposé ci dessus, laisse leur mail lors de la commande sur addon.

Cela me permettra de mieux vous identifier.

Bonne journée

Link to comment
Share on other sites

Merci Pourpresta pour la modification express du module.
Ca répond parfaitement à mon besoin, maintenant, je peux faire apparaitre mes numéros de série sur les BL et Factures par l'intermédiaire des messages envoyés aux clients. Il me suffit de décider lesquels doivent s'afficher.
Cordialement.

Link to comment
Share on other sites

  • 2 months later...

bonjour
ça fait des jours a chercher exactement a ajouter un champ texte a mes commandes a travers le BO mais j'arrive pas.
moi aussi ça m’intéresse cette modification.
Pourpresta, est ce tu peut m'aider moi aussi a résoudre ce problème?
merci d'avance.

Link to comment
Share on other sites

merci Ecom pour m'avoir répondu
c'est quoi le nom du module modifié par Pourpresta et que t'a permis d'afficher le numéro de série de tes produits?
Moi je veux faire la même chose que toi zeff (post #10) c'est a dire afficher une ligne de texte personnalisé sous le nom du produit dans la facture PDF mais je ne sais pas comment.
Pourriez vous me guider vu que t'a résolu ton problème? entre temps je contact Pourpresta en espérant qu'il me répond.
merci de nouveaux

Link to comment
Share on other sites

  • 3 weeks later...

bonjour a tous
moi aussi je suis intéressé par cette manipulation.
je peut pas acheter le module “Messages client sur le BL v1.0” de chez moi (MAROC) et je tiens a faire cette modification pour ma boutique.
comment faire pour avoir un petit texte personnalisé sur les factures? est ce qu'il y a d'autre piste??
merci

Link to comment
Share on other sites

  • 3 years later...

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...